Range and Efficiency

While the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max (2025-...) offers a longer real-world range and a bigger battery, it is less energy-efficient than the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…).

Property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max
Range (EPA) 531 km 660 km
Range (WLTP) 673 km - Range (WLTP)
Range (GCC) 537 km 627 km
Battery Capacity (Nominal) 125 kWh 147 kWh
Battery Capacity (Usable) 118 kWh 140 kWh
Efficiency per 100 km 22 kWh/100 km 22.3 kWh/100 km
Efficiency per kWh 4.55 km/kWh 4.48 km/kWh

Charging

Both vehicles utilize a standard 400-volt architecture.

The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max (2025-...) offers faster charging speeds at DC stations, reaching up to 220 kW, while the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…) maxes out at 200 kW.

The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max (2025-...) features a more powerful on-board charger, supporting a maximum AC charging power of 11.5 kW, whereas the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…) is limited to 11 kW.

Property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max
Max Charging Power (AC) 11 kW 11.5 kW
Max Charging Power (DC) 200 kW 220 kW
Architecture 400 V 400 V
Charge Port CCS Type 2 CCS Type 1

Performance

Both vehicles are all-wheel drive.

Both cars deliver the same 0-100 km/h acceleration time, but the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…) boasts greater motor power.

Property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max
Drive Type AWD AWD
Motor Type PMSM (front), PMSM (rear) PMSM (front), PMSM (rear)
Motor Power (kW) 400 kW 397 kW
Motor Power (hp) 536 hp 532 hp
Motor Torque 858 Nm 827 Nm
0-100 km/h 4.7 s 4.7 s
Top Speed 210 km/h 209 km/h

Dimensions

The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max (2025-...) is wider and taller, but about the same length as the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…).

The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…) boasts a more extended wheelbase.

Property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max
Length 5125 mm 5100 mm
Width (with Mirrors) 2157 mm 2238 mm
Width (w/o Mirrors) 1959 mm 2082 mm
Height 1718 mm 1955 mm
Wheelbase 3210 mm 3076 mm

Cargo and Towing

The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…) features a larger trunk, but the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max (2025-...) offers greater maximum cargo capacity when the rear seats are folded.

A frunk (front trunk) is available in the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max (2025-...), but the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…) doesn’t have one.

The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max (2025-...) is better suited for heavy loads, offering a greater towing capacity than the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C (2023-…).

Property Mercedes EQS SUV 580 4MATIC Rivian R1S Dual-Motor Max
Number of Seats 5, 7 5, 7
Curb Weight 2845 kg 3025 kg
Cargo Volume (Trunk) 645 l 481 l
Cargo Volume (Max) 2100 l 2548 l
Cargo Volume (Frunk) - Cargo Volume (Frunk) 314 l
Towing Capacity 1800 kg 3492 kg
